Project Management Tools

Project Management Tools

These tools help teams organize, track, and complete work efficiently, especially in tech and software development projects.


1. 📌 Trello

🔍 What is it?

Trello is a visual task management tool based on the Kanban method. It uses boards, lists, and cards to represent tasks and progress.

🛠 Key Features:

  • Boards = your entire project

  • Lists = project stages (To Do, Doing, Done)

  • Cards = individual tasks

  • Add deadlines, attachments, checklists, labels, and team members to each card

👥 Best for:

  • Small teams, freelancers, students, startups

✅ Pros:

  • Easy to use

  • Free version available

  • Mobile and desktop apps

  • Great for visual thinkers


2. 🛠 Jira (by Atlassian)

🔍 What is it?

Jira is a professional-grade tool used by software teams to manage Agile projects (Scrum/Kanban), track bugs, and plan sprints.

🛠 Key Features:

  • Epics, tasks, subtasks

  • Sprint planning & tracking

  • Bug tracking and workflows

  • Reports: Burndown charts, velocity, etc.

  • Integrations: GitHub, Bitbucket, Confluence

👥 Best for:

  • Developers, testers, product owners, Agile teams

  • Medium to large tech companies

✅ Pros:

  • Deep customization

  • Powerful analytics and reporting

  • Robust integrations

  • Designed for software teams


3. ✅ Asana

🔍 What is it?

Asana is a task and workflow management tool with calendar views, timelines, and visual dashboards.

🛠 Key Features:

  • Projects in list, board, or timeline view

  • Assign tasks, subtasks, due dates, and tags

  • Built-in calendar and dashboard

  • Real-time team collaboration

  • Integrates with Slack, Google Drive, and more

👥 Best for:

  • Marketing teams, HR, event planning, startups

  • Cross-functional teams needing coordination

✅ Pros:

  • Clean interface

  • Easy onboarding

  • Good for non-technical users

  • Free version for small teams


4. 🧑‍💻 GitHub

🔍 What is it?

GitHub is a code hosting platform based on Git, allowing developers to collaborate, track changes, and deploy software.

🛠 Key Features:

  • Repositories to store code

  • Branches for parallel development

  • Pull Requests for code review and collaboration

  • Issues to track bugs, tasks, and discussions

  • GitHub Actions for automation (CI/CD)

👥 Best for:

  • Software developers, DevOps, open-source contributors

  • Any team using version control (Git)

✅ Pros:

  • Industry-standard for code collaboration

  • Free for open-source projects

  • Built-in version control

  • Advanced DevOps tools


📊 Summary Table

Tool Best For Key Strengths
Trello Simple project tracking Visual interface, beginner-friendly
Jira Agile development teams Deep reporting, Scrum/Kanban support
Asana General task management Timelines, dashboards, team-friendly
GitHub Software/code collaboration Git-based version control, CI/CD features

🧠 Final Tips

  • New to project tools? Start with Trello or Asana

  • Working in Agile software development? Choose Jira

  • Building apps or writing code? Always use GitHub

Note: All information provided on the site is unofficial. You can get official information from the websites of relevant state organizations